| Gannet:
I’m willing to give the display a try Peter, so I’ll order one up, what’s bothering me that the scope is sometimes very difficult to ‘turn on’ and often turns off at random. So there’s a bigger issue somewhere? Praps I was a bit quick on celebrating. Cheers George |
| pcprogrammer:
Hi George, the turning of could be a thermal protection of the main regulator, since it is drawing ~30% more current. The difficulty in turning it on might be related and depends on when it happens. As you can see in the schematic, the power switch only controls an enable to the SPX29302T5, which makes the latter the actual power on part. It could have problems turning on when there is too much initial current being drawn. But this is not my field of expertise. Did you check the other voltages in the scope, like the 1.2V, 2.5V, 3V and of course the 3.3V? Another one is VREF which should be ~1.25V. Regards, Peter |
